Understanding the role of an AI prompt engineer
An AI prompt engineer specializes in designing effective prompts to guide the behavior and output of AI models. He deeply understands Natural Language Processing (NLP), Machine Learning and AI systems.
The primary goal of an AI prompt engineer is to fine-tune and optimize AI models by crafting precise prompts that align with specific use cases, ensure desired outputs, and better control.

develop essential skills
To excel as an AI prompt engineer, certain skills are important:
NLP and language modeling
A strong understanding of transformer-based constructs, the language model, and the NLP approach is essential. Effective rapid engineering requires an understanding of the pre-training and fine-tuning procedures used by language models such as ChatGPT.
programming and machine learning
Expertise in programming languages like Python and familiarity with frameworks like TensorFlow or PyTorch for machine learning is important. Success depends on a solid understanding of data preprocessing, model training, and evaluation.

collaboration and communication
Prompt engineers will often work with other teams. Excellent written and verbal communication skills are required to work effectively with stakeholders, explain immediate needs, and understand project goals.
Educational Background and Learning Resources
A strong educational base is beneficial in pursuing a career as an AI prompt engineer. The necessary knowledge in areas such as NLP, machine learning, and programming can be obtained with a bachelor’s or master’s degree in computer science, data science, or a similar discipline.
Additionally, one can supplement their education and stay updated on the latest advances in AI and prompt engineering by using online tutorials, classes and self-study materials.
gain practical experience
Gaining real-world experience is essential to proving your abilities as an AI prompt engineer. Look for projects, research internships, or research opportunities where one can use early engineering methods.
A person’s abilities can be demonstrated, and concrete proof of their knowledge provided, by starting their own accelerated engineering projects or by contributing to open-source projects.
networking and job market references
As an AI prompt engineer, networking is essential to finding employment opportunities. Attend AI conferences, join online forums, attend AI related events, and network with industry experts. Stay informed about job listings, AI research facilities, and organizations focused on NLP and AI optimization.
